Why Can China Make Rapid Progress in Artificial Intelligence?
BEIJING, June 5, 2025 /PRNewswire/ -- Finding Answers in China from China.org.cn: Why Can China Make Rapid Progress in Artificial Intelligence? In 2025, China runs in a fast lane of artificial intelligence (AI) development as the country has made a...
A humanoid robot fell, a small stumble on its road to the future
BEIJING, April 30, 2025 /PRNewswire/ -- A news report from China.org.cn on the world's first-ever half-marathon for both humanoid robots and human runners: A humanoid robot fell, a small stumble on its road to the future At a half-marathon race, a...